MANILA, Philippines — Four flood control projects in Bulacan amounting to over P330 million have been flagged by the Commission on Audit (COA) for alleged irregularities after it found “ghost” structures, unauthorized project relocations, and unsupported claims of completion, implicating some officials of the Department of Public Works and Highways (DPWH) and Wawao Builders. In a statement released on Thursday, the Commission on Audit (COA) announced that it had recently filed four fraud audit reports (FARs) with the Independent Commission for Infrastructure, involving projects under the DPWH Bulacan 1st District Engineering Office, with a total cost of P330,512,956.97.
